I. Overview of Probe Interface Board PCBA

The Probe Interface Board PCBA serves as a core component in semiconductor testing equipment, primarily functioning to connect and transmit signals between Automatic Test Equipment (ATE) and the Device Under Test (DUT). It establishes reliable electrical contact with wafers or packaged chips through precision probes or sockets, enabling the input, output, and feedback of test signals with exceptional accuracy.

Core Functions

A professionally engineered High-Precision Probe Interface Board delivers stable, low-loss electrical connections between the tester and the chip, while converting the tester's standardized interface into specialized configurations compatible with various chip packages. Through advanced Impedance-Controlled Probe Board design principles, it ensures superior Signal Integrity Probe PCBA performance during high-frequency transmission, effectively minimizing signal distortion. The architecture supports multi-channel parallel testing for enhanced throughput and incorporates a replaceable probe card design that simplifies maintenance, upgrades, and reduces overall testing costs.

III. Probe Interface Board PCBA Manufacturing Process Flow

PCB Manufacturing Stage

The fabrication of a High-Speed Probe Interface PCBA begins with high-precision pattern transfer and exposure, followed by vacuum etching and AOI inspection. Impedance testing and TDR verification ensure every Impedance-Controlled Probe Board meets stringent signal integrity requirements before multilayer lamination and precision drilling complete the foundation.

Component Procurement and Inspection

Strict BOM verification protocols are enforced, with procurement conducted exclusively through original manufacturer channels. Incoming Quality Control (IQC) inspection utilizing X-Ray and microscopy guarantees component authenticity and reliability.

SMT Assembly

Solder paste printing with SPI inspection initiates the assembly process, followed by high-speed placement supporting components as small as 0201. Dual inspection through AOI and X-Ray verification ensures placement accuracy, particularly critical for fine-pitch BGA and QFN packages in any High-Density Probe Interface PCB project.

Post-soldering & Conformal Coating

Selective wave soldering, conformal coating, and potting protect the assembly against environmental stresses. For Rigid-Flex Probe Interface PCBA designs, specialized handling procedures preserve the integrity of flexible sections.

Testing & Reliability Verification

Every Signal Integrity Probe PCBA undergoes flying probe testing, functional circuit testing (FCT), burn-in testing, thermal cycling from -40°C to +85°C, and comprehensive signal integrity validation before shipment.

II. Manufacturing Challenges (Core Pain Points) for Probe Interface Board PCBAs

As an experienced Probe Interface PCBA China Supplier, Minkinzi understands the intricate technical challenges involved in producing high-performance Probe Interface Board PCBAs. The following table summarizes the core manufacturing pain points we address daily:

Challenge CategorySpecific Technical Challenges
High-Frequency Signal IntegrityMust support GHz-level signal transmission; extremely strict requirements for impedance control (±5% or even ±3%), insertion loss, and return loss.
High-Frequency Material SelectionUses high-frequency substrates such as Rogers RO4350B, RO4003C, PTFE, and Isola; complex mixed-lamination processes with FR-4.
High-Layer-Count StructureTypically 8–20 layers; strict requirements for stack-up symmetry and Z-axis Coefficient of Thermal Expansion (CTE) control.
High-Density Interconnect (HDI)Fine circuitry (3mil/3mil), micro-vias/blind & buried vias (HDI Any-layer), BGA/PGA packaging.
Gold Finger/Contact ReliabilityGold plating thickness (options of 30μ" or 50μ"), nickel layer density, and high durability requirements for mating cycles.
Impedance Matching PrecisionStrict matching (e.g., 100Ω differential, 50Ω single-ended); TDR testing must meet design specifications.
Thermal DesignPCB thermal resistance control for high-current testing scenarios; metal substrate or embedded copper block structures.
DFM/DFT CollaborationHighly customized mechanical and electrical interfaces for ATE systems and probe cards.

PCB Manufacturing Expertise (Categorized by Material and Structure)

High-Frequency / High-Speed Material PCBs

For RF Probe Interface Board Assembly and high-frequency signal test applications, Minkinzi fabricates PCBs using premium low-loss materials, including PTFE-based laminates such as Rogers RO4003C, RO4350B, and RO3003, Taconic TLX/TLY/TLC series, and Isola I-Tera MT40. We also work with advanced low-loss high-speed materials such as Mitsubishi CCL-HL832, Panasonic MEGTRON 6/7, and TU-872 SLK. These materials are ideal for high-frequency probe interface boards, 5G/RF test boards, and high-speed digital test interface boards where signal integrity is critical.

Specialty FR-4 / High-Tg Materials

For robust thermal and electrical performance, we offer High-Tg FR-4 materials (Tg ≥ 150°C) including Shengyi S1000H/S1130, ITEQ IT-180A, and IS410, as well as high-CTI, low-loss, mid-Tg materials and halogen-free eco-friendly laminates. These substrates are widely used for Probe Card Interface Board Assembly, load boards, burn-in boards, and other heat- and high-voltage-resistant test boards used in IC validation and ATE Probe Interface Board PCBA platforms.

Multilayer Boards and Advanced HDI PCBs

Minkinzi manufactures multilayer boards ranging from 4 to 58 layers, including Any-Layer HDI structures with 1-step, 2-step, 3-step, and 4-step HDI tiers. Our capabilities include microvia, buried via, and blind via structures for high-density routing. These advanced builds are essential for Semiconductor Probe Interface Board designs, Wafer Probe Interface PCBA substrates, and high-density DUT boards used in high-pin-count IC testing.

Heavy Copper / Mixed Copper Thickness PCBs

To support high-current testing environments, we offer heavy copper processes in 2oz, 3oz, 4oz, 6oz, and 10oz copper weights, along with mixed copper thickness structures combining different inner and outer layer weights. These are widely used in ATE power test boards, load boards, and high-current probe cards where power delivery and thermal dissipation are critical.

Specialty Structure PCBs

Minkinzi supports complex mechanical and structural requirements, including depth-controlled drilling, back drilling and stub removal for signal integrity, step slots, counterbores, and countersinks, castellated holes, plated edge holes, Rigid-Flex PCBs for space-constrained probe interface modules, and ultra-thin core structures (≤ 0.05mm) for compact Industrial Probe Interface Board designs.


PCB Surface Finishes and Special Processes

To address the specific requirements of probe contact areas, Minkinzi provides a comprehensive range of surface finishes and impedance-controlled processes:

Process TypeApplication Scenario
Electrolytic Hard GoldProbe contact points, test pads, gold fingers
ENIG (Electroless Nickel/Immersion Gold)General-purpose pads, BGA areas
Immersion Silver / OSP / Immersion TinGeneral soldering areas
ENEPIG (Electroless Nickel/Electroless Palladium/Immersion Gold)Dual-process: wire bonding + soldering
Selective Gold PlatingLocalized gold fingers, probe contact points
Gold Plating Thickness Control30μ"–100μ" (customizable)
Ultra-low Roughness Copper Foil (HVLP3 / RTF2)High-frequency signal integrity requirements
Impedance Control (Tolerance ±5%–±10%)Single-ended / Differential / 50Ω / 90Ω, etc.

These finishes are optimized for long-life probe contact reliability, low contact resistance, and excellent solderability — all essential for high-cycle IC Testing Probe Interface Board performance.

Comprehensive PCB Material Portfolio

Standard FR4 Materials

Material TypeCharacteristicsTypical Applications
FR4 Standard Tg (Tg 130–140°C)Low cost, high cost-performance, excellent machinabilityConsumer electronics, home appliances, toys
FR4 Mid-Tg (Tg 150°C)Improved heat resistance, low Z-axis expansionIndustrial control, automotive electronics
FR4 High-Tg (Tg ≥ 170°C)High heat resistance, excellent PTH reliabilityCommunication equipment, automotive electronics, power supplies
FR4 High-Speed (Low-Loss FR4)Low Dk/Df, minimal signal loss5G communication, servers, networking equipment

High-Frequency, High-Speed & Specialty Materials

Material TypeBrand BenchmarksCharacteristicsTypical Applications
PTFE (Polytetrafluoroethylene)Rogers RO4350B, RO4003CExtremely low loss, stable dielectric constantRadar, satellites, millimeter-wave
PI (Polyimide)DuPont Pyralux, TaiflexFlexible, high-temperature resistantFlexible circuits (FPC), aerospace
Metal-Based (Aluminum-Based)Aluminum Core MCPCBExcellent heat dissipationLED lighting, automotive headlights, power modules
Ceramic-BasedAl₂O₃, AlN, BeOUltra-high thermal conductivity, high-frequency insulationHigh-power LEDs, IGBTs, optical modules
BT Resin-BasedMitsubishi BTHigh Tg, low dielectric loss, low thermal expansionSemiconductor packaging substrates (BGA/CSP)
PPE/PPO Modified Resin BoardsPanasonic MEGTRON seriesUltra-low loss, excellent high-frequency performance100G+ high-speed networking, AI servers
